BOZEMAN — The best volleyball rivalry in the state of Montana will be renewed on Thursday night, with a state championship berth on the line.
Gallatin, the defending state champs, and Bozeman, the runner-up from last season, each won twice on Wednesday, on the first day of the Class AA state tournament, to advance to the undefeated semifinal in what will be a rematch of the 2024 championship match.
Gallatin and Bozeman were also part of a clean sweep by the Eastern AA in the first round, improving the league's record to 20-0 against Western AA teams on the first day of the state tournament dating back to 2020.
